C# Introduction
What is C#?
C# is pronounced "C-Sharp".
It is an object-oriented programming language created by Microsoft that runs on the .NET Framework.
C# has roots from the C family, and the language is close to other popular languages like C++ and Java.
The first version was released in year 2002. The latest version, C# 12, was released in November 2023.
C# is used for:
- Mobile applications
 - Desktop applications
 - Web applications
 - Web services
 - Web sites
 - Games
 - VR
 - Database applications
 - And much, much more!
 
Why Use C#?
- It is one of the most popular programming language in the world
 - It is easy to learn and simple to use
 - It has a huge community support
 - C# is an object oriented language which gives a clear structure to programs and allows code to be reused, lowering development costs
 - As C# is close to C, C++ and Java, it makes it easy for programmers to switch to C# or vice versa
